
Doubt keeps you looking down because you are not seeking guidance from God. Doubt is an enemy tactic used throughout time to lure people away from God. It is such a powerful emotion that it was the primary way the serpent would deceive Eve in the Garden of Eden before the fall into sin. Genesis 3:1The serpent was the shrewdest of all the wild animals the Lord God had made. One day, he asked the woman, “Did God really say you must not eat the fruit from any of the trees in the garden?” [1]
In this verse, we discover that our enemy is cunning and will use any means to destroy the relationship between God and Adam and Eve. The serpent in the question to Eve is trying to make her question God’s goodness and motives. Is God holding something back from you? When we converse with the enemy, we will lose if we rely on our strength and wisdom. In the fall of Adam and Eve, the serpent easily outwitted them, even in their sinless condition. We can only thwart the enemies’ deceiving ways with God’s strength and the Holy Spirit working against us.
When I Doubt, I Can Go to God
Sometimes, we may doubt God, but we don’t have to stay there. Something happens when we seek God to help us overcome our doubts and look up to Him. To look up is to focus on what God says and not our circumstances. If you doubt the goodness of God, He may bring to your heart to meditate on a verse. John 3:16For this is how God loved the world: He gave his one and only Son, so that everyone who believes in him will not perish but have eternal life.[2]
God reassures us of His love as we meditate on this verse and let it soak into our hearts. When we place our faith in Him, we have eternal life. When Satan tempted, Jesus continually quoted God’s word to counter the temptation. We should do the same. As we take our doubts to Jesus, He becomes a bridge to safety, helping us walk over and above our misgivings.
Is Doubt Normal?
Is doubt normal? This is a question many believers contemplate. We are in a constant spiritual battle; doubt can creep in when we look down or our circumstances are overwhelming. Thomas, one of Jesus’s disciples, even doubted until he saw the resurrected Jesus. There is nothing wrong with telling God you have doubts and allowing Him to meet you where you are.
Spending time in God’s word is one of the most powerful tools to counter doubt. When we spend time in God’s word, something happens in the spiritual realm that helps us to look to the Lord again and overcome our doubts. The truth of God’s word lifts us up and gives us discernment. Proverbs 3:5Trust in the Lord with all your heart; do not depend on your own understanding. 6 Seek his will in all you do, and he will show you which path to take. [3]
